Linseed oil, also known as flaxseed oil or flax oil (in its edible form), is a colourless to yellowish oil obtained from the dried, ripened seeds of the flax plant (Linum usitatissimum).The oil is obtained by pressing, sometimes followed by solvent extraction.Linseed oil is a drying oil, meaning it can polymerize into a solid form. This is what makes pure linseed oil paint different: It is a penetrating paint, not a surface coating.Use the same paint outdoors and indoors and for all coats – no primer required.When painting on untreated, dried timber outdoors, first impregnate with Allbäck Purified Raw Linseed Oil for even longer-lasting protection. Viscous oils such as linseed stand oil will add body to a medium, but need a certain amount of thinning with a solvent or with a more free-flowing oil such as cold-pressed linseed oil, to reduce drag when brushing out. Purified linseed oil reduces the consistency of the paint and slows the speed of drying, allowing the artist ample time to work and refine a particular passage of the painting without pressure.
